Federal Reserve Chairman Ben Bernanke has been summoned to appear before the House of Representatives' Budget Committee on Oct. 20 to testify on a potential second economic stimulus package.

Democratic leaders at Capitol Hill are reportedly pondering the introduction of a second economic stimulus bill. The Wall Street Journal, citing congressional aides, reported that House Speaker Nancy Pelosi is considering recommendations from economists to introduce a second stimulus package that could cost taxpayers $300 billion.

Bernanke is scheduled to testify at 10 a.m. EDT about the impact of economic stimulus plans in weakened economies.
